Kendi VideoKonferans yazılımınızı yapın! Açık kaynak Kodlu video konferans uygulaması EduMeet
- 10 Eylül 2017
- Yayınlayan: debian
- Kategoriler: Açık kaynak Kodlu Uygulamalar, Gündem
Yorum yapılmamış
Kendi VideoKonferans yazılımınızı yapın! Açık kaynak Kodlu video konferans uygulaması EduMeet
EduMeet, açık kaynak kodlu bir web tabanlı video konferans uygulamasıdır. Özellikle eğitim amaçlı tasarlanmıştır ve öğretmenlerin öğrencileriyle etkileşimde bulunmasını sağlamak için geliştirilmiştir. İşte EduMeet’in bazı özellikleri:
- Kullanım Kolaylığı: EduMeet, kullanıcı dostu bir arayüz sunar ve kullanıcıların kolayca video konferanslara katılmalarını sağlar. Herhangi bir uygulama veya eklenti yüklemeye gerek duymadan, web tarayıcısı üzerinden erişilebilir.
- HD Video ve Ses: EduMeet, yüksek kaliteli video ve ses iletimi sağlar. Bu, katılımcıların net bir şekilde görüşmeler yapmalarını ve sesli olarak iletişim kurmalarını sağlar.
- Çoklu Katılımcı Desteği: EduMeet, birçok kullanıcının aynı video konferansa katılabilmesini sağlar. Bu, öğretmenlerin birden fazla öğrenciyle aynı anda etkileşime geçebilmelerini sağlar.
- Sohbet ve Paylaşım: EduMeet, kullanıcıların metin tabanlı sohbet yapmalarına olanak tanır. Ayrıca, dosya paylaşımı da desteklenir, böylece sunumlar, dokümanlar veya diğer dosyalar kolayca paylaşılabilir.
- Ekran Paylaşımı: EduMeet, kullanıcıların ekranlarını diğer katılımcılarla paylaşmalarını sağlar. Bu özellik, sunum yapma veya bir konunun üzerinde birlikte çalışma gibi senaryolarda öğretmenlerin veya öğrencilerin ekranlarını gösterebilmelerini sağlar.
- Oturum Kontrolü: EduMeet, oturumları yönetmek için bazı kontroller sunar. Örneğin, oturumu başlatma, katılımcıları düzenleme veya oturumu sonlandırma gibi yeteneklere sahiptir.
- Açık Kaynak Kodlu: EduMeet, açık kaynak kodlu bir projedir. Bu, geliştiricilerin kaynak koduna erişebilmesini ve ihtiyaçlarına göre uygulamayı özelleştirmesini veya geliştirmesini sağlar.
EduMeet, eğitimde uzaktan iletişimi kolaylaştıran ve kullanıcı dostu bir çözüm sunan bir uygulamadır. Ayrıca, güvenlik önlemleri ve gizlilik politikaları da önemli bir odak noktasıdır.
Peki, kritik kurumlarda EduMeet uygulaması kullanılabilir mi? Cevabı elbette evet. Bazı değişiklikler yaptıktan sonra kullanılması mümkündür.
İşte bu unsurlardan bazıları;
- Güvenlik:
- Veri Şifreleme: Kritik standartta bir videokonferans uygulaması, güvenli iletişimi sağlamak için güçlü bir veri şifreleme mekanizması kullanmalıdır. Örneğin, end-to-end şifreleme ile tüm iletişim kanalları korunabilir. (OpenSSL, GnuPG (GNU Privacy Guard), VeraCrypt)
- Kimlik Doğrulama: Kullanıcıların kimlik doğrulaması için güvenilir yöntemler kullanılmalıdır. Örneğin, iki faktörlü kimlik doğrulama (2FA) veya askeri standartlara uygun kimlik doğrulama protokolleri kullanılabilir. (FreeOTP, Google Authenticator)
- Kullanıcı Yönetimi:
- Yetkilendirme ve Erişim Kontrolü: Kullanıcıların rolleri ve yetkileri, askeri standartlara uygun şekilde tanımlanmalı ve yönetilmelidir. Örneğin, toplantı oluşturma, kaydetme veya ek katılımcı davet etme gibi işlevler, uygun izinlere sahip olan kullanıcılara verilmelidir. (OpenLDAP, FreeIPA, Keycloak)
- Ölçeklenebilirlik ve Performans:
- Yük Dengeleme: Uygulamanın yüksek trafiği işleyebilmesi için yük dengeleme mekanizmaları kullanılabilir. Bu, kullanıcıların akıcı bir videokonferans deneyimi yaşamasını sağlar. (HAProxy, Nginx)
- Sunucu Kümeleri: Büyük ölçekli videokonferans sistemleri için sunucu kümeleri oluşturulabilir. Bu, yüksek kullanıcı sayılarına ve taleplere yanıt verebilirlik sağlar. (Kubernetes, Docker Swarm)
- Ses ve Görüntü Kalitesi:
- Codec Desteği: Ses ve video codec’leri, askeri standartlara uygun şekilde seçilmeli ve desteklenmelidir. Yüksek kaliteli ses ve görüntü aktarımı için uygun codec’ler kullanılmalıdır. (WebRTC (Web Real-Time Communication), FFmpeg)
- Bant Genişliği Yönetimi: Videokonferans uygulaması, farklı bant genişliklerinde çalışabilme kabiliyetine sahip olmalıdır. Bu, kullanıcıların düşük bant genişliği ortamlarında bile sorunsuz bir deneyim yaşamasını sağlar. (Traffic Control (tc), iptables)
- Kaynak Kod Denetimi:
- Açık Kaynaklı Proje: EduMeet gibi açık kaynaklı bir temel proje kullanarak, uygulamanın kaynak kodunu denetleyebilir ve güvenlik açıklarını tespit etmek ve geliştirmeler yapmak için askeri standartlara uygun değişiklikler yapabilirsiniz. (SonarQube)
